Xinema (Free).


Xinema was created due to the lack of full screen playing functionality in Apple's QuickTime Player. It's designed to be an easy solution to this problem. Instead of purchasing QuickTime Pro for $30, you can get this feature for free with Xinema. Xinema provides a floating controller for pausing, fast-forwarding and adjusting the sound volume.

To play a movie, simply drag it from the Finder, drop it on Xinema, and click the Play button.
